Setting up Linux systems

If you are using a Linux system (generally in a production environment), you need to manage an extra setup to improve performance or to resolve production problems with many indices.

This recipe covers the following two common errors that happen in production:

  • Too many open files that can corrupt your indices and your data
  • Slow performance in search and indexing due to the garbage collector

Big problems arise when you run out of disk space. In this scenario, some files can become corrupted. To prevent your indices from corruption and possible data loss, it is best to monitor the storage spaces. Default settings prevent index writing and block the cluster if your storage is over 95% full.
